Paris, 17th July 2018

Omnes Capital invests in Marquetis & Co, a communications agency specialising in operational marketing, and arranges the mezzanine debt for the deal Levine Keszler advises Omnes Capital

Paris-based operational marketing group Marquetis & Co is restructuring its capital and strengthening its development with Omnes. Active on the French marketing and communications market since 1996, the Marquetis Group, headquartered in Boulogne Billancourt, has been run for more than 20 years by the management team of Virginie Massa and Evangelos Vatzias. The Marquetis Group operates through its subsidiaries, Marquetis One, Marquetis Connect and Marquetis Call. It offers a 360° service, from global communications consultancy to automated cross-channel marketing in SaaS mode.

The group has a portfolio of loyal customers made up of key accounts from a variety of sectors (automotive, services, insurance, banking, etc.). The group generated sales of nearly €20m in 2017, with profitability of 15%.

After a year of growth in 2017, the group’s shareholding changed: Virginie Massa, the agency’s CEO, became its chairman and took a majority stake, while Evangelos Vatzias became a minority shareholder and reinvested in the project. The management team reaffirmed its confidence in the directors and retained a stake of almost 20%. The transaction is financed through mezzanine debt, provided by Omnes Capital, and senior debt, provided by BNP Paribas and Neuflize OBC.

Levine Keszler advised Omnes Capital on the legal due diligence of the Marquetis Group and the negotiation of the transaction documentation.
